Who is St. Joseph?
In the Catholic traditions, Saint Joseph is the patron saint of workers. Because of that, many people will pray to him if they find themselves in financial straits or when they feel like they need assistance with a pressing concern. Trying to sell your house fast certainly seems to qualify, especially if you need to sell your house due to financial constraints, a relocation, a lifestyle change, or one of many other reasons. Catholic believers have also been known to pray to Saint Joseph on issues concerning their marriages, jobs, and life situations where they might be experiencing a struggle or having a hard time moving forward.

There are a few different ways you can go about it. The easiest is the belief that if you say the St. Joseph prayer every day while you are trying to sell your house, he will eventually give you good fortunes and help the process move along a little faster.
There’s a second level to the prayer process if you really want to ensure the effectiveness of Saint Joseph’s help. You’ll need to acquire a St. Joseph statue in order to complete the full process. It’s very easy to find these statues online at places such as Amazon.com or at a local shop. When you buy the statue, it should come with a full kit. That kit usually includes a miniature shovel and a prayer card that you can keep handy.
What’s that shovel for? Well, that’s needed because, in order for the prayer to be the most effective it can be, you need to bury that Saint Joseph statue underneath your front lawn. When it comes to the specifics and most effective way to bury the statue, there are some competing theories. However, the most popular belief is that you want to bury the Saint Joseph statue upside down in your front lawn. You also want to make sure he is facing your house, which is meant to make it clear to Saint Joseph that he should be focused on helping your house as he helps to sell it quickly.
What if you live in a condo, apartment, or place with no front lawn? That’s okay, you can bury the statue in a plant pot close to your front door. Just make sure he’s upside down and facing your residence so he knows who to help.
If you’re worried about the statue getting messed up or broken due to the elements or harsh conditions, consider putting him inside a cloth, bag, or small box. That won’t impact the power of the prayer or the statue. Many people do this regardless out of respect to the statue and Saint Joseph, though he doesn’t seem to mind either way.

What Is the St Joseph Prayer?
Once you’ve buried the statue, you’ll want to say the following prayer once a day.
O, Saint Joseph, you who taught our Lord the carpenter’s trade, and saw to it that he was always properly housed, hear my earnest plea. I want you to help me now as you helped your foster-child Jesus, and as you have helped many others in the matter of housing. I wish to sell this [house/property] quickly, easily, and profitably and I implore you to grant my wish by bringing me a good buyer, one who is eager, compliant, and honest, and by letting nothing impede the rapid conclusion of the sale.
Dear Saint Joseph, I know you would do this for me out of the goodness of your heart and in your own good time, but my need is very great now and so I must make you hurry on my behalf.
Saint Joseph, I am going to place you in a difficult position with your head in darkness and you will suffer as our Lord suffered, until this [house/apartment/property] is sold. Then, Saint Joseph, I swear before the cross and God Almighty, that I will redeem you and you will receive my gratitude and a place of honor in my home.
Amen.
